Double glazing that failed to work.

It can be extremely frustrating and costly to fix misted double glazing that is misting. However, it is possible to decrease the chance of it happening by being aware of the indications.

Double glazing units are made of two panes separated by a gas chamber. The gas acts as insulation and heat retention. If the seal around the unit is not properly sealed air may get in the gap and create mist.

Condensation is another common issue, especially during winter months. The liquid residue that is left on the outside of windows is not pleasant to look at and could be an indication of leaks.

To remove condensation, it might be required to use a humidifier. It is also a good idea to inspect the seals on your glass. They must be cleaned regularly and cleaned using non-abrasive solvents.

Another thing to consider is whether the window is damaged on both sides or just one. If it's only on one side, it may be too weak to support a brand new double glazed unit.

A faulty seal could also cause a double-glazed unit with a failing seal to fail. This could be caused by age, damage or other causes. It is recommended to have the item replaced.

The condensation can occur on windows This is a very common issue. When warm air collides with an icy surface, the temperature difference results in condensation. Double-glazing is where it occurs most often between the glass panes.

Triple glazing

Triple-glazed windows are an excellent option to improve your home. They offer better insulation, less heating bills, and increased security. However, it is important to be aware that they are not cheap. The price of installing them can differ based on your budget and the size of your house. It is recommended to get several quotes before making a decision.

It is crucial to get a quote from a company when installing windows. This is crucial because the cost could quickly add up.

The cost of triple glazed windows is dependent on the number of windows in your home. Typical prices range between PS4,500 and PS5,100 for a semi-detached home with five windows. A larger home with twelve windows could cost as much as PS6,000.

For a terraced two-bedroom house with four windows the cost will be around PS2,300. For larger homes the installation will cost between PS3,500 and PS4,500.

There are many aspects that can affect the cost of an installation, including the type of material used, type of frame and the quality of the window. Whether you choose to buy new windows or replace the windows you have the cost of installation will depend on the needs of your.

Triple glazing is a great idea for those who live in more cold climates. Triple glazing can help reduce heating costs by keeping heat inside the house and reduce condensation and draughts. As a bonus it can also aid to increase the value of your home.

Although triple-glazed windows are generally more expensive than double-glazed ones, they offer numerous benefits. They provide better insulation and improve the value of your home and lower your energy bills.

Secondary glazing

If you're looking for a method to improve the comfort in your home and cut down on your energy costs, secondary glazing could be the solution for you. Secondary glazing can be a great option to conserve energy and provide you with an added sense of security.

Secondary glazing can be affixed to existing windows, without the need for brand new ones. It works by encapsulating air between a second glass layer and the primary window. This provides insulation and helps reduce drafts and heat loss.

There are many types of secondary glazing each with its own advantages. For example vertical sliding secondary glass is perfect for rehabilitating or upgrading older properties. It is important to note that not all kinds of secondary glazing are suitable for listed buildings.

Another issue is that certain kinds of secondary glazing might require planning permission. Double-glazing is not usually required to be installed, but approval is required for secondary glazing systems that are used in listed buildings.

Plastic panes are also prone to fogging. An alternative that is more affordable is acrylic, which is ten times stronger than glass. Whether you choose traditional or ultra-slim system secondary glazing is an excellent option to increase your energy efficiency.

In addition to providing good insulation Secondary glazing is an excellent option to make your home more secure. You can select a hinged or sliding version that can open and close as a casement window.
